Graphics were designed in photoshop
Coding was done in VHDL
Compiled in Quartus II 9.2 Web Edition
Running on an Altera DE2 FPGA
Description:
-For our final project in ECE 385, I created a top-down tank fighting game for two players.
- Each player gets their own set of directional and attack keys on the keyboard
- Each player is allowed to shoot a single projectile at once, then must wait until it has exploded in order to fire again
- Each player can take two shots before being killed, score is kept track of until either player reaches a total of 10 rounds won, then the game is over
- Obstacle locations are pseudo-random and are calculated from switches and other factors
- 2 Power ups available per round, blue and red (only blue shown in video). Red power up increases projectile size, Blue power up increases projectile speed
